Yes! At the end of each course, your child will receive a digital certificate of participation.
Lessons are held weekly on Google Meet, on the same day and time each week. The meeting link is shared through Google Classroom. Students will need a Gmail address to join — they can use a parent’s email or create one of their own.
A maximum of 2 years. This helps mentors adapt the lesson to the learning level of all students in the group.
Yes! Our courses are designed to work even on older laptops, as long as there’s a working internet connection.
Each group has its own schedule, set by the mentor. Before the course starts, you’ll be able to choose a group that works best for your schedule from the available options.
We run 3 sessions per school year — in fall, winter, and spring. We announce the exact start date 2–3 weeks in advance, once mentors are confirmed.
Each group has a maximum of 6 students. This helps mentors give individual support to every child.
Each course has 8–10 lessons, each 1.5 hours long. Lessons take place once a week, on the same day and time.
Each course has several modules that increase in difficulty. Each module includes 10 lessons. In one course session, students complete one module. First-time students start with Module 1. If they sign up again, we place them in the next module.
